Thank you! I am trying to play around with different orientations based on what I have seen recommended on other builds with this case. Currently this is:
2x Noctua NF-A12 bottom intake
1x Noctua NF-A12 rear intake
1x Noctua NF-A14 top exhaust

They are not reverse fans and it based on what I have seen it brings air to cpu from the back and air to the gpu from the bottom and the exhaust on the right makes sure that air doesn't just go in the rear and right back out by having it on the other side
